The 7 day weather forecast summary for Cerler, Spain:

Taking a look at the forecast over the coming week and the average daytime maximum will be around 7°C, with a high of 13°C expected on Sunday afternoon. The average minimum temperature for the week ahead will be around 0°C, dipping to its lowest on Thursday morning at -5°C. Monday is expected to see the most precipitation with around 38mm, or about 1.5inches anticipated. The strongest wind will be felt on Friday afternoon, coming from the southwest, and reaching around 6mph, that's about 10km/h.
